LEHMAN-ROBERTS COMPANY - A PROUD TRADITION SINCE 1939
Lehman-Roberts, a Granite Company, has been a part of the fabric of Memphis for more than 85 years. We are dedicated to the manufacturing and placement of quality hot mix asphalt along with surface mining of aggregates from our sister company Memphis Stone & Gravel. Anchoring our company's efforts are the core values of stewardship, humility, continuous improvement, and relationships. With manufacturing facilities located throughout West Tennessee and North Mississippi, we specialize in asphalt production and construction projects ranging from commercial projects to miles of interstate highway paving throughout the Mid-South.
General Summary
This position supervises the maintenance and repair of heavy equipment used in heavy civil construction operations to ensure equipment is safe, reliable, and available to support project needs. The role leads maintenance personnel, coordinates preventive maintenance and repair activities, and ensures compliance with safety, environmental, regulatory, and manufacturer requirements.
Essential Job Accountabilities
Supervise mechanics, welders, field service technicians, oilers, and shop personnel to ensure maintenance work is completed safely, accurately, and in alignment with operational priorities.
Schedule and prioritize preventive maintenance, inspections, and repairs to maximize fleet availability, minimize downtime, and support project execution.
Coordinate maintenance activities for earthmoving, paving, crushing, hauling, and support equipment to improve equipment reliability and maintain operational readiness.
Review equipment condition reports, repair needs, and maintenance trends to develop repair plans that align resources with business and project priorities.
Monitor equipment utilization, reliability, repair history, and downtime trends to identify recurring issues and support continuous improvement in fleet performance.
Ensure accurate and timely completion of work orders, repair records, parts usage, and maintenance documentation to support compliance, cost tracking, and future planning.
Oversee diagnostics, troubleshooting, repairs, and major component rebuilds for heavy equipment to restore performance, extend service life, and reduce repeat failures.
Provide technical guidance on hydraulic, engine, electrical, powertrain, emissions, air brake, and electronic control systems to support complex repairs and safe equipment operation.
Collaborate with operations, project teams, dispatch, OEM representatives, and vendors to coordinate repairs, warranty claims, and technical support that reduce delays and support project readiness.
Manage parts procurement, inventory needs, maintenance costs, and budget inputs to help maintain required resources and support financial accountability.
